
Windows Vista with SP1 installed is a smoother ride than without SP1 installed - I particularly like being able to see accurate progress indications when I'm moving or copying files. SP1 doesn't add any new features to Windows Vista, but it improves the overall experience of using the OS. I have it running on all five desktop PCs in my home, but I've completely struck out trying to get it installed on my Dell XPS M1330 laptop. When SP1 first came out there were some issues with it not being compatible with certain hardware configurations, so when my first attempt to install it failed, I thought my M1330 might have had one of those particular hardware configurations that were affected.
When it started showing up in Windows Update for me on the M1330, I gave it a shot - and it still failed. This past week I decided to dig deeper into the problem and really figure out why it wasn't installing. Since the Windows Update mechanism wasn't installing it properly, I downloaded the big 400+ MB offline installer and gave that a try. It also failed on me, giving me the following error:
